A section of Machakos County MCAs say they firmly #RejectFinanceBill2024 and stand with the people.

A group of Machakos County MCAs have taken a stand to vehemently reject the Finance Bill 2024, aligning themselves with the sentiments of the people. This bold move showcases their commitment to advocating for the best interests of the community.
